🍠🥬 Yam Pottage with Veggies (9+ months)
Ingredients:
-
½ cup soft yam cubes (peeled and diced)
-
1 tablespoon finely chopped vegetables (e.g., spinach, carrots, or green beans)
-
1 tsp onion (minced)
-
1 small tomato (blended or chopped)
-
A drop of palm oil or unsalted butter (optional)
-
A splash of water or low-sodium chicken broth
👩🍳 Instructions:
-
Cook Yam and Veggies:
-
In a small pot, add yam cubes, tomato, onion, and enough water to cover.
-
Simmer on low heat until yam is soft (10–12 minutes).
-
Add the chopped veggies in the last 3–5 minutes of cooking.
-
-
Mash and Combine:
-
Once soft, mash yam and veggies lightly together to desired texture.
-
Add a drop of palm oil or butter if using for extra flavor and healthy fat.
-
-
Cool and Serve:
-
Let the pottage cool slightly.
-
Serve warm in a baby bowl.

✅ Nutritional Benefits:
-
Yam: Rich in complex carbs and fiber
-
Leafy greens & carrots: Packed with iron, beta-carotene, and vitamins
-
Palm oil or butter: Provides vitamin A and healthy fats
